Early Morning Storm

Posted on Mar 28th, 2008 by Kathryn : Believer Kathryn

Early Morning Storm


The melody of the rain trickles into my dreams,

Lulling me back to consciousness as droplets pelt my window.

It's 2:43 a.m., and the wind slaps branches against my glass.

The leaves are stripped and released into puddles--plip, plop, plip.

Thunder growls in the background as lightning briefly illuminates the drenched landscape.

I yearn to stand outside and let the water flow over my pale flesh.

For the moment, I will be contented to lie in bed listening, listening.

As the rain's song woke me, the lullaby calls sleep back to my body.
